Slovakia

Workers sacked for organising wage protest

The management of the Austrian based multinational Neusiedler in Ruzomberok, a town in central Slovakia, has decided to hand out redundancy notices to all workers who were involved in organising a new trade union.

The decision to break away from the existing KOZ trade union came after workers took the initiative to launch a petition for higher wages. Slovak workers earn about a third of what is paid in the Hungarian sister company and about one eighth of what is being paid in Austria. One of the factory meetings demanding higher wages was attended by 300 workers.

Over the last two years the Slovak government has implemented a brutal neo-liberal shock therapy. To attract foreign investment they have introduced a flat tax on income, corporate profits and retail sales of 19%, partly privatised the pension system and raised the retirement age from 58 for women with children and 60 for men to 62 years for everyone. Overall unemployment in Slovakia stands at 16% and the national average income is about €250 (or £174) a month. Near the capital Bratislava however average incomes are about 90% of the EU level, a sign of how a very rapid gap between a very rich minority and a poor majority of the population has developed since the reintroduction of capitalism, accelerated by EU membership.

The petition that demanded a wage increase of 50 SK per hour (1.25 Euro or £0.8) has been signed by 1223 workers. Factory management reacted by sacking the organisers of this action and the official KOZ trade union threatened workers that signing the petition could mean provoking "legal action" against them.

As a reaction to the outright betrayal of the official trade union, workers have begun building a new trade union, called OOZ Papier. Last weekend the new organisation had unionised a 1000 workers in the Neusiedler plant. ZOO Papier is organising solidarity from other factory and public service workers in the city and is preparing for city wide actions or possibly strikes to widen the struggle. Organisers of ZOO Papier have invited Socialistická alternativa Budoucnost, the CWI affiliate in the Czech Republic, to participate in their struggle.
